Le Petit Palais, construit à l'occasion de l'Exposition universelle de 1900 par l'architecte Charles Girault, abrite le musée des Beaux-Arts de la ville de Paris. Il est situé à Paris 8e, avenue Winston-Churchill, face au Grand Palais.
Il s'agit de l’un des quatorze musées de la ville de Paris, gérés depuis le par l'établissement public administratif « Paris Musées ».
